despite the case
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"despite the case"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to indicate that something is true or valid regardless of a particular situation or circumstance. Example: "Despite the case that the weather was unfavorable, the event continued as planned."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"despite the case", ensure that the statement following it is logically connected and clearly demonstrates the contrast you intend to convey.
Common error
Avoid using "despite the case" when the situation actually influences the outcome. This phrase should be reserved for instances where the stated situation is irrelevant to the final result.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"despite the case" functions as a prepositional phrase that introduces a contrast or concession. It indicates that a statement remains valid or an action occurs, irrespective of the specific circumstances or situation, Ludwig's analysis confirms the grammatical correctness and usability of the phrase.

FAQs
How can I use "despite the case" in a sentence?
Use "despite the case" to show that something remains true or occurs regardless of a specific circumstance. For example, "Despite the case's complexity, there is only one judge investigating."
What are some alternatives to "despite the case"?
Alternatives include "regardless of the situation", "in spite of the facts", or "notwithstanding the circumstances".
Is "despite the case" formal or informal?
"Despite the case" can be used in various contexts, but it tends to appear more frequently in formal or professional writing than in casual conversation.
How does "despite the case" differ from "despite the fact"?
"Despite the case" generally refers to a specific situation, whereas "despite the fact" introduces a statement that is undeniably true and contrasts with the rest of the sentence. "Despite the case" emphasizes circumstance, "despite the fact" emphasizes truth.
